What do I look for in a hand cream? I must love the fragrance. It must actually make my hands feel more comfortable and nourished. I hate that film and sticky feeling some of the creams can leave on your hands, why would I want to wash that off my hands which defeats the point.   1. Liz Earle Superskin Hand Serum No beauty recommendation would be
    Lifestyle Lady appropriate if it did not include Liz Earle. I love her brand and range of skin care. This is the first time I have used the serum (I think it’s new to the collection.) It does not disappoint. This is next to my bed, it is a serum so I feel it is more nourishing than a standard cream and this is reflected in the cost, it is the most expensive item I have on my list. In my view worth every penny. It has a light fragrance of essential oils and I am very attracted to its botanical nature and the fact it’s natural and does not contain any uglies or nasties. This is typical of the fanstastic standard of Liz Earle and I am glad I have a backup ready.
  2. Bath & Bodyworks Fresh Tangerines Hand Cream This was a spontaneous buy, I am getting more familiar with the brand. I have always found the candy smell in their stores a little off putting but I sucked it up and bought this and I have not been disappointed. I will tell you I am a sucker for anything that smells of Clementines, Tangerines or Oranges. I love the clean smell and it just reminds me of summer. So this was a no brainier purchase. I obviously love the fragrance but their is a variety of other scents in the collection. For $5 this is such great value and the cream is soothing, comfortable and nourishing.
  3. Elizabeth Arden Eight Hour Hand Treatment As one would expect of Elizabeth Arden this is great, it is a cult classic. It is probably closest to the Liz Earle and I turn to this when my hands are really dry and need a treat. If you are a fan of the Eight Hour range than this will be for you.
  4. Mangiacotti Hand Repair I purchased this when I went to the hairdresser they were selling this range. Again it was the fragrance which drew me in. You will see from the photo that it is almost empty so that should tell you all you need to know. I will repurchase if I can source it.
  5. Cath Kidston Flora Hand Cream Collection This was a Christmas present from Mr L. He is sick of holding my scraggy hands, yes we still hold hands occasionally – who says romance is dead?! I didn’t have high hopes for this and I have been proved wrong. I adore the fragrances and they are nourishing and creamy. Good job Mr L a great stocking stuffer.
  6. L’Occitane Hand Creams If you have followed the blog for a while like Liz Earle L’Occitane is another one of the brands I love. TBH L’Occtiane to me knocks it out of the park when it comes to their hand and foot creams. They sell them in such a variety of fragrances and sizes. I am NEVER without one in my purse and they are a beauty staple. There is a reason why it’s loved by The Green Beauty Bible. Treat yourself give it a try.
